Kiosk watchdog (Lanternbox fleet). Each kiosk runs a watchdog that restarts the Fernwheel app if heartbeats stop for 90 seconds. Three restarts in ten minutes triggers a hard reboot and pages on-call. Do not disable the watchdog remotely; it masks display-driver hangs we're still tracking. Logs land in the device journal under the watchdog unit. If a site reports a boot loop, pull the journal before power-cycling. Escalation steps and known failure signatures are documented on the page below.

runbook for badug-kadup: https://confluence.zemvarlabs.internal/projects/browse/display/projects/bd1b

## TKT-2291: DocLint signature check failing on publish

The Swiftmere documentation linter (DocLint) rejects the latest ruleset bundle with SIG_MISMATCH. Publishes are blocked. Likely cause: the ruleset was re-signed after last week's rotation but the verifier cache on node fennel-2 still holds the old key. Flush the cache, then re-verify against the current signing key below.

signing key of bagap-yawep = bky13_TbfT6ZMUoGJo2

- [ ] **Step 7: Breaker override escrow.** After sealing the signing keys for the Tallgrove upstream API circuit breaker, confirm the support team can force the breaker open during a full outage. The override bundle lives in the sealed escrow drawer and is useless without its unlock phrase. Two ceremony witnesses must initial this step before proceeding. The escrow bundle is decrypted with the recovery passphrase that follows.

vault phrase of kahip-kahop = holath-quenmir